TikTok will let you use an AI prompt to turn a photo into a video

TikTok has a new AI-powered tool called “AI Alive” that will let you turn photos into video with a prompt to describe what you want the video to look like. It’s a little different from other

You can access the tool from TikTok’s Story Camera, and it uses “intelligent editing tools that give anyone, regardless of editing experience, the ability to transform static images into captivating, short-form videos enhanced with movement, atmospheric and creative effects,” according to a blog post.

I tested the tool with a few pictures from my camera roll. After picking the photo, I could enter a prompt; TikTok initially filled the prompt box with “make this photo come alive.” Uploading usually took a few minutes, though the videos themselves were just a few seconds long. It also failed to make a picture where I asked it to make a cat jump and have an anime style into an anime.

TikTok says it has some safety measures in place for the videos. “To help prevent people from creating content that violates our policies, moderation technology reviews the uploaded photo and written AI generation prompt as well as the AI Alive video before it’s shown to the creator,” TikTok says in the blog post. “A final safety check happens once a creator decides to post to their Story.” The video will also be labeled as AI-generated and will have C2PA metadata embedded.
